Sprint To The Finish?

My name is Murrell, and I've been with Sprint for my cell phone service for over 4 years.  They are the only company I've ever been with, and until a few months ago, there was never a problem.  Then at the start of 2011, they started updating their towers to 4G, and their network fell apart.  I was told in January it was a 2 year process that they are trying to get done in 6 months, and we are now in April, and I'm still being told it will be a few months. 

Basically what's been happening is that around 6:00 PM or so, my phone struggles to connect to the Sprint network.  If I try to send a text, it seems to take 7 or 8 tries.  If I try to use the internet, I'll either get a message that says the page is not working, or I have to reload the page several times to get the page to load completely.  And forget making a phone call.  That is the most difficult task for my phone at night.

So after a couple of trips to different Sprint stores, and a couple of calls to Customer Service, I've finally given up.  I can't keep paying for unlimited texts and data if my phone doesn't work.  Sprint told me the fee to cancel early (my contract ends in August) was $50 for each month remaining on my contract.  So I dropped to a cheaper plan.  The cheapest plan I could get was $40 a month, so that is how I will sprint to the finish of my contract.  Then I will look elsewhere.
